Meadowbank, New South Wales, Australia

Overview

Meadowbank is a peaceful riverside suburb in Sydney's inner northwest, celebrated for its green spaces, waterfront walks, and easy city access. With its strong community feel and growing array of cafes, it's a relaxing urban escape just 20 minutes from Sydney CBD.

Best Time to Visit

September to November or March to May for comfortable temperatures and fewer crowds.

Local Tips

Take advantage of the scenic riverside paths for jogging or cycling, and use the Meadowbank Station for rapid transit to central Sydney.

Cultural Etiquette

No tipping is expected but rounding up is appreciated. Dress is casual; swimwear should be reserved for the water only.

Safety Warnings

Meadowbank is generally safe, but watch for bicycle traffic near the river and avoid isolated river paths at night.

Hidden Gems

Explore Anderson Park for local birdwatching, or hop over Bennelong Bridge for a lesser-known walking route to modern Rhodes precinct shops.
